I am using Premiere Elements 15. I am guessing this is very easy, but I can't seem to figure it out. I have a project with multiple video clips. I am adding musical scores to them using the built in scores. I want the music to change. So for example, I inserted the Aura score to the timeline. Then after that, I added the Outer Space score after the Aura score on the timeline. These scores automatically have blank spaces at the beginning and end of each score, i.e., no music plays at the end of the Aura score or the beginning of the Outer Space score. I don't want it to be that way. I want the music to go right from the Aura score to the Outer Space score with no gaps in the music. Is that possible?

The automatic scoring appears to have built in fades in and out.
Try putting them on separate tracks with an overlap. If you get the overlap right it seems to work pretty good ... at least when I tried it.
To do this I moved the video to Track 3. Then I moved the audio scores to tracks 1 and 2.
